outplacement programmes are a valuable resource offered by companies to support employees who have been laid off or are in the process of transitioning to a new role. These programmes provide a range of services and support to help individuals secure a new job and adjust to the transition.
One of the main benefits of outplacement programmes is the support and guidance they offer to employees during a difficult time. Losing a job can be a stressful and overwhelming experience, but outplacement programmes can help ease the burden by providing valuable resources such as career counseling, job search assistance, resume writing services, interview coaching, and networking opportunities.
By providing these services, companies can demonstrate their commitment to their employees’ well-being even after they have left the organization. This can help maintain positive relationships with former employees and protect the company’s reputation in the long run.
outplacement programmes also benefit employers by helping to mitigate the negative impact of layoffs on employee morale and productivity. When employees are provided with the support they need to transition to a new job, they are more likely to leave on positive terms and speak highly of their former employer. This can help protect the company’s brand and maintain good relationships with both current and former employees.
In addition, outplacement programmes can help employers avoid legal disputes and potential negative publicity that may arise from layoffs. By providing resources to support employees during the transition, companies can show that they value their employees and are committed to helping them succeed even after leaving the organization.
Another key benefit of outplacement programmes is that they can help employees find a new job more quickly and efficiently. The job market is competitive, and finding a new job can be a daunting task. outplacement programmes provide employees with the tools and resources they need to navigate the job search process successfully.
From resume writing and interview preparation to networking and job search strategies, outplacement programmes offer a wide range of services to help employees land their next role. This support can make a significant difference in how quickly and successfully employees are able to find a new job.
Outplacement programmes can also help employees identify new career opportunities and explore different paths they may not have considered before. Career counseling and guidance provided through these programmes can help employees gain new insights into their skills and interests, leading to more fulfilling and rewarding career choices in the future.
